Transaction 2114709075927cefdcd310e2675ce15dc46871e529e24825919dc39204b688a8
1 Input
1 Output
-
2114709075927cefdcd310e2675ce15dc46871e529e24825919dc39204b688a8:0
- value
- 3565700
- script pubkey
- OP_0 OP_PUSHBYTES_20 684f065229288d0110574796cb53450b2e637b9b
- address
- bc1qdp8sv53f9zxszyzhg7tvk569pvhxx7umca4rly